Good Goats Make Good Neighbors

Civil Eats

The goats are part of a growing trend of using livestock to mitigate wildfire risks across the West. Beyond general grazing permits, which the Forest Service has issued since its inception, Thibideau says that last year his region used livestock to graze 4,544 acres specifically to mitigate wildfire.

Waste and Water Woes

National Sustainable Agriculture Coalition

CAFOs — specifically their large manure lagoons — are also a huge source of methane , a potent greenhouse gas, as well as ammonia, hydrogen sulfide and particulate matter, 3 all of which pose risks to human health. Livestock have the potential to be valued less for meat, dairy and wool and more for the waste they produce.
